Question nouveau

Plus d'informations
il y a 7 ans 4 semaines #23356 par Faye
nouveau a été créé par Faye
:)<br><br>Message édité par: Simba, à: 26/05/17 19:32

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 7 ans 4 semaines #23358 par Laurent Dardenne
Réponse de Laurent Dardenne sur le sujet Re:Nouveau quota dossier
Simba écrit:

Quelqu'un aurait-il des idées pour réaliser ce script oubien m'aiguiller?

Crée une fonction de calcul de quota, exemple :
[code:1]
Measure-UserQuota($Quota_Source)
{
if ($Quota_Source rules1)
{return $Quota_Cible}
elseif ($Quota_Source rules2)
{return $Quota_Cible}
elseif ($Quota_Source rulesn)
{return $Quota_Cible}
else {return $Quota_Cible}
}
[/code:1]
ensuite le reste devrait suivre, qq dans le genre :
[code:1]
Import-csv
$Quota_Cible=Measure-UserQuota $Quota_Source
set-data
Export-csv
[/code:1]<br><br>Message édité par: Laurent Dardenne, à: 22/03/17 18:33

Tutoriels PowerShell

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 7 ans 3 semaines #23366 par Faye
Réponse de Faye sur le sujet Re:Nouveau quota dossier
J'ai appliqué ceci mais dans mon fichier csv de sortie, le résultat est toujours statique : $Quota_cible = 500 pour tous.
Comment faire pour que ma sortie prenne en compte ma fonction?



Message édité par: Simba, à: 23/03/17 15:24<br><br>Message édité par: Simba, à: 26/05/17 19:34
Pièces jointes :

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 7 ans 3 semaines #23368 par Laurent Dardenne
Réponse de Laurent Dardenne sur le sujet Re:Nouveau quota dossier
Simba écrit:

Comment faire pour que ma sortie prenne en compte ma fonction?

Un seul appel fonctionne, il se peut que le type string du fichier CSV soit en cause.
Simba écrit:

Je joins le fichier csv de test

Crée un autre poste car il n'a pas été téléchargé.

Tutoriels PowerShell

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 7 ans 3 semaines #23369 par Laurent Dardenne
Réponse de Laurent Dardenne sur le sujet Re:Nouveau quota dossier
Test :
[code:1]
Measure-UserQuota 500
#500
Measure-UserQuota 510
#1024
Measure-UserQuota '510 '
#1024
Measure-UserQuota '50 '
#500
Measure-UserQuota ' 510'
500
[/code:1]
Pour le dernier cas la donnée renvoie effectivement 500.

Tutoriels PowerShell

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 7 ans 3 semaines #23370 par Faye
Réponse de Faye sur le sujet Re:Nouveau quota dossier
Oui il ne prenait pas en compte les fichiers csv.
J'ai mis l'extension sous forme de txt

La pièce jointe Test.txt est absente ou indisponible

Pièces jointes :

Connexion ou Créer un compte pour participer à la conversation.

Temps de génération de la page : 0.077 secondes
Propulsé par Kunena